As Senior Finance Analyst, Business Partner, you'll be the go-to financial advisor for Legal, HR, Corporate Affairs, and other G&A functions, helping leaders understand their costs, find the story behind the numbers, and solve real business problems alongside teams like GL, HR, and Operations.

We are seeking a motivated, detail-oriented Financial Analyst who thrives in a collaborative, business-facing environment. This role offers significant ownership, exposure to senior leaders, and the opportunity to accelerate your development in a fast-paced organization.

Hybrid working model, Krakow, Quattro Business Park (3 days per week from the office) ​​

Key Responsibilities:

  • Act as trusted finance business partner for Legal, HR, Corporate Affairs, and other G&A functions, translating budgets and financial data into clear, actionable insight.

  • Own the annual budgeting process and monthly/quarterly forecasting for your functions, tracking performance against plan.

  • Prepare monthly reporting packages (actuals vs. budget, forecast, and prior year) and deliver deep-dive analyses of cost drivers, KPIs, headcount trends, and cost allocation impacts to leadership.

  • Partner cross-functionally with GL, HR, Operations, and finance leadership to identify root causes, drive practical solutions, and lead process-improvement initiatives.

  • Perform ad hoc analysis to turn complex data into a clear financial story for business leaders.

Basic Qualifications

  • Bachelor's and/or master's degree in Finance, Accounting, or related field.

  • 4+ years' experience as a Financial Analyst.

  • Excellent Microsoft Excel skills; working knowledge of SAP, Hyperion, and Business Objects strongly preferred; familiarity with Power BI or similar data visualization tools is a plus.

  • Fluent in English (CEFR C1 or higher).

Desired Characteristics

  • Strong verbal and written communication skills, with the ability to translate technical and financial data into clear business implications for CEO staff and senior leadership.

  • Strong analytical skills, with the ability to manage multiple priorities simultaneously with speed and accuracy.

  • Proactive, high-energy approach with the ability to quickly grasp new ideas, systems, and tasks.

  • Demonstrated success working in a matrixed, multi-cultural, global organization.

  • History of leading cross-functional projects focused on process improvement.

  • Curiosity and openness to using AI and automation tools to streamline reporting, analysis, and forecasting.

  • Willingness to learn and develop functional understanding of the G&A functions supported.
